[PATCH v2 03/11] arm64: dts: qcom: x1e80100: Add CAMSS block definition
Posted by Bryan O'Donoghue 3 weeks, 1 day ago
Add dtsi to describe the xe180100 CAMSS block

4 x CSIPHY
3 x TPG
2 x CSID
2 x CSID Lite
2 x IFE
2 x IFE Lite

Signed-off-by: Bryan O'Donoghue <bryan.odonoghue@linaro.org>

 arch/arm64/boot/dts/qcom/hamoa.dtsi | 367 ++++++++++++++++++++++++++++++++++++
 1 file changed, 367 insertions(+)

diff --git a/arch/arm64/boot/dts/qcom/hamoa.dtsi b/arch/arm64/boot/dts/qcom/hamoa.dtsi
index 38f9da6ad9ca5..c62187856a451 100644
--- a/arch/arm64/boot/dts/qcom/hamoa.dtsi
+++ b/arch/arm64/boot/dts/qcom/hamoa.dtsi
@@ -16,6 +16,7 @@
 #include <dt-bindings/interconnect/qcom,x1e80100-rpmh.h>
 #include <dt-bindings/interrupt-controller/arm-gic.h>
 #include <dt-bindings/mailbox/qcom-ipcc.h>
+#include <dt-bindings/phy/phy.h>
 #include <dt-bindings/phy/phy-qcom-qmp.h>
 #include <dt-bindings/power/qcom,rpmhpd.h>
 #include <dt-bindings/power/qcom-rpmpd.h>
@@ -5543,6 +5544,372 @@ cci1_i2c1: i2c-bus@1 {
 			};
 		};
 
+		camss: isp@acb7000 {
+			compatible = "qcom,x1e80100-camss", "simple-mfd";
+
+			reg = <0 0x0acb7000 0 0x2000>,
+			      <0 0x0acb9000 0 0x2000>,
+			      <0 0x0acbb000 0 0x2000>,
+			      <0 0x0acc6000 0 0x1000>,
+			      <0 0x0acca000 0 0x1000>,
+			      <0 0x0acb6000 0 0x1000>,
+			      <0 0x0ace4000 0 0x1000>,
+			      <0 0x0ace6000 0 0x1000>,
+			      <0 0x0ace8000 0 0x1000>,
+			      <0 0x0acec000 0 0x4000>,
+			      <0 0x0acf6000 0 0x1000>,
+			      <0 0x0acf7000 0 0x1000>,
+			      <0 0x0acf8000 0 0x1000>,
+			      <0 0x0ac62000 0 0xf000>,
+			      <0 0x0ac71000 0 0xf000>,
+			      <0 0x0acc7000 0 0x2000>,
+			      <0 0x0accb000 0 0x2000>;
+
+			reg-names = "csid0",
+				    "csid1",
+				    "csid2",
+				    "csid_lite0",
+				    "csid_lite1",
+				    "csid_wrapper",
+				    "csiphy0",
+				    "csiphy1",
+				    "csiphy2",
+				    "csiphy4",
+				    "csitpg0",
+				    "csitpg1",
+				    "csitpg2",
+				    "vfe0",
+				    "vfe1",
+				    "vfe_lite0",
+				    "vfe_lite1";
+
+			clocks = <&camcc CAM_CC_CAMNOC_AXI_NRT_CLK>,
+				 <&camcc CAM_CC_CAMNOC_AXI_RT_CLK>,
+				 <&camcc CAM_CC_CORE_AHB_CLK>,
+				 <&camcc CAM_CC_CPAS_AHB_CLK>,
+				 <&camcc CAM_CC_CPAS_FAST_AHB_CLK>,
+				 <&camcc CAM_CC_CPAS_IFE_0_CLK>,
+				 <&camcc CAM_CC_CPAS_IFE_1_CLK>,
+				 <&camcc CAM_CC_CPAS_IFE_LITE_CLK>,
+				 <&camcc CAM_CC_CPHY_RX_CLK_SRC>,
+				 <&camcc CAM_CC_CSID_CLK>,
+				 <&camcc CAM_CC_CSID_CSIPHY_RX_CLK>,
+				 <&camcc CAM_CC_CSIPHY0_CLK>,
+				 <&camcc CAM_CC_CSI0PHYTIMER_CLK>,
+				 <&camcc CAM_CC_CSIPHY1_CLK>,
+				 <&camcc CAM_CC_CSI1PHYTIMER_CLK>,
+				 <&camcc CAM_CC_CSIPHY2_CLK>,
+				 <&camcc CAM_CC_CSI2PHYTIMER_CLK>,
+				 <&camcc CAM_CC_CSIPHY4_CLK>,
+				 <&camcc CAM_CC_CSI4PHYTIMER_CLK>,
+				 <&gcc GCC_CAMERA_HF_AXI_CLK>,
+				 <&gcc GCC_CAMERA_SF_AXI_CLK>,
+				 <&camcc CAM_CC_IFE_0_CLK>,
+				 <&camcc CAM_CC_IFE_0_FAST_AHB_CLK>,
+				 <&camcc CAM_CC_IFE_1_CLK>,
+				 <&camcc CAM_CC_IFE_1_FAST_AHB_CLK>,
+				 <&camcc CAM_CC_IFE_LITE_CLK>,
+				 <&camcc CAM_CC_IFE_LITE_AHB_CLK>,
+				 <&camcc CAM_CC_IFE_LITE_CPHY_RX_CLK>,
+				 <&camcc CAM_CC_IFE_LITE_CSID_CLK>;
+
+			clock-names = "camnoc_nrt_axi",
+				      "camnoc_rt_axi",
+				      "core_ahb",
+				      "cpas_ahb",
+				      "cpas_fast_ahb",
+				      "cpas_vfe0",
+				      "cpas_vfe1",
+				      "cpas_vfe_lite",
+				      "cphy_rx_clk_src",
+				      "csid",
+				      "csid_csiphy_rx",
+				      "csiphy0",
+				      "csiphy0_timer",
+				      "csiphy1",
+				      "csiphy1_timer",
+				      "csiphy2",
+				      "csiphy2_timer",
+				      "csiphy4",
+				      "csiphy4_timer",
+				      "gcc_axi_hf",
+				      "gcc_axi_sf",
+				      "vfe0",
+				      "vfe0_fast_ahb",
+				      "vfe1",
+				      "vfe1_fast_ahb",
+				      "vfe_lite",
+				      "vfe_lite_ahb",
+				      "vfe_lite_cphy_rx",
+				      "vfe_lite_csid";
+
+			interrupts = <GIC_SPI 464 IRQ_TYPE_EDGE_RISING>,
+				     <GIC_SPI 466 IRQ_TYPE_EDGE_RISING>,
+				     <GIC_SPI 431 IRQ_TYPE_EDGE_RISING>,
+				     <GIC_SPI 468 IRQ_TYPE_EDGE_RISING>,
+				     <GIC_SPI 359 IRQ_TYPE_EDGE_RISING>,
+				     <GIC_SPI 477 IRQ_TYPE_EDGE_RISING>,
+				     <GIC_SPI 478 IRQ_TYPE_EDGE_RISING>,
+				     <GIC_SPI 479 IRQ_TYPE_EDGE_RISING>,
+				     <GIC_SPI 122 IRQ_TYPE_EDGE_RISING>,
+				     <GIC_SPI 465 IRQ_TYPE_EDGE_RISING>,
+				     <GIC_SPI 467 IRQ_TYPE_EDGE_RISING>,
+				     <GIC_SPI 469 IRQ_TYPE_EDGE_RISING>,
+				     <GIC_SPI 360 IRQ_TYPE_EDGE_RISING>;
+
+			interrupt-names = "csid0",
+					  "csid1",
+					  "csid2",
+					  "csid_lite0",
+					  "csid_lite1",
+					  "csiphy0",
+					  "csiphy1",
+					  "csiphy2",
+					  "csiphy4",
+					  "vfe0",
+					  "vfe1",
+					  "vfe_lite0",
+					  "vfe_lite1";
+
+			interconnects = <&gem_noc MASTER_APPSS_PROC QCOM_ICC_TAG_ACTIVE_ONLY
+					 &config_noc SLAVE_CAMERA_CFG QCOM_ICC_TAG_ACTIVE_ONLY>,
+					<&mmss_noc MASTER_CAMNOC_HF QCOM_ICC_TAG_ALWAYS
+					 &mc_virt SLAVE_EBI1 QCOM_ICC_TAG_ALWAYS>,
+					<&mmss_noc MASTER_CAMNOC_SF QCOM_ICC_TAG_ALWAYS
+					 &mc_virt SLAVE_EBI1 QCOM_ICC_TAG_ALWAYS>,
+					<&mmss_noc MASTER_CAMNOC_ICP QCOM_ICC_TAG_ALWAYS
+					 &mc_virt SLAVE_EBI1 QCOM_ICC_TAG_ALWAYS>;
+			interconnect-names = "ahb",
+					     "hf_mnoc",
+					     "sf_mnoc",
+					     "sf_icp_mnoc";
+
+			iommus = <&apps_smmu 0x800 0x60>,
+				 <&apps_smmu 0x820 0x60>,
+				 <&apps_smmu 0x840 0x60>,
+				 <&apps_smmu 0x860 0x60>,
+				 <&apps_smmu 0x18a0 0x0>;
+
+			#address-cells = <2>;
+			#size-cells = <2>;
+			ranges;
+
+			phys = <&csiphy0 PHY_TYPE_DPHY>, <&csiphy1 PHY_TYPE_DPHY>,
+			       <&csiphy2 PHY_TYPE_DPHY>, <&csiphy4 PHY_TYPE_DPHY>;
+			phy-names = "csiphy0", "csiphy1",
+				    "csiphy2", "csiphy4";
+
+			power-domains = <&camcc CAM_CC_IFE_0_GDSC>,
+					<&camcc CAM_CC_IFE_1_GDSC>,
+					<&camcc CAM_CC_TITAN_TOP_GDSC>;
+			power-domain-names = "ife0",
+					     "ife1",
+					     "top";
+
+			status = "disabled";
+
+			ports {
+				#address-cells = <1>;
+				#size-cells = <0>;
+
+				port@0 {
+					reg = <0>;
+					#address-cells = <1>;
+					#size-cells = <0>;
+					camss_csiphy0_inep0: endpoint@0 {
+						reg = <0>;
+					};
+				};
+
+				port@1 {
+					reg = <1>;
+					#address-cells = <1>;
+					#size-cells = <0>;
+					camss_csiphy1_inep0: endpoint@0 {
+						reg = <0>;
+					};
+				};
+
+				port@2 {
+					reg = <2>;
+					#address-cells = <1>;
+					#size-cells = <0>;
+					camss_csiphy2_inep0: endpoint@0 {
+						reg = <0>;
+					};
+				};
+
+				port@3 {
+					reg = <3>;
+					#address-cells = <1>;
+					#size-cells = <0>;
+					camss_csiphy4_inep0: endpoint@0 {
+						reg = <0>;
+					};
+				};
+			};
+
+			csiphy0: phy@ace4000 {
+				compatible = "qcom,x1e80100-csi2-phy";
+				reg = <0 0x0ace4000 0 0x2000>;
+
+				clocks = <&camcc CAM_CC_CSIPHY0_CLK>,
+					 <&camcc CAM_CC_CSI0PHYTIMER_CLK>,
+					 <&camcc CAM_CC_CAMNOC_AXI_RT_CLK>,
+					 <&camcc CAM_CC_CPAS_AHB_CLK>;
+				clock-names = "csiphy",
+					      "csiphy_timer",
+					      "camnoc_axi",
+					      "cpas_ahb";
+
+				operating-points-v2 = <&csiphy_mxc_opp_table>;
+
+				interrupts = <GIC_SPI 477 IRQ_TYPE_EDGE_RISING>;
+
+				power-domains = <&camcc CAM_CC_TITAN_TOP_GDSC>,
+						<&rpmhpd RPMHPD_MXC>,
+						<&rpmhpd RPMHPD_MMCX>;
+				power-domain-names = "top",
+						     "mx",
+						     "mmcx";
+
+				#phy-cells = <1>;
+
+				status = "disabled";
+			};
+
+			csiphy1: phy@ace6000 {
+				compatible = "qcom,x1e80100-csi2-phy";
+				reg = <0 0x0ace6000 0 0x2000>;
+
+				clocks = <&camcc CAM_CC_CSIPHY1_CLK>,
+					 <&camcc CAM_CC_CSI1PHYTIMER_CLK>,
+					 <&camcc CAM_CC_CAMNOC_AXI_RT_CLK>,
+					 <&camcc CAM_CC_CPAS_AHB_CLK>;
+				clock-names = "csiphy",
+					      "csiphy_timer",
+					      "camnoc_axi",
+					      "cpas_ahb";
+
+				operating-points-v2 = <&csiphy_mxc_opp_table>;
+
+				interrupts = <GIC_SPI 478 IRQ_TYPE_EDGE_RISING>;
+
+				power-domains = <&camcc CAM_CC_TITAN_TOP_GDSC>,
+						<&rpmhpd RPMHPD_MXC>,
+						<&rpmhpd RPMHPD_MMCX>;
+				power-domain-names = "top",
+						     "mx",
+						     "mmcx";
+
+				#phy-cells = <1>;
+
+				status = "disabled";
+			};
+
+			csiphy2: phy@ace8000 {
+				compatible = "qcom,x1e80100-csi2-phy";
+				reg = <0 0x0ace8000 0 0x2000>;
+
+				clocks = <&camcc CAM_CC_CSIPHY2_CLK>,
+					 <&camcc CAM_CC_CSI2PHYTIMER_CLK>,
+					 <&camcc CAM_CC_CAMNOC_AXI_RT_CLK>,
+					 <&camcc CAM_CC_CPAS_AHB_CLK>;
+				clock-names = "csiphy",
+					      "csiphy_timer",
+					      "camnoc_axi",
+					      "cpas_ahb";
+
+				operating-points-v2 = <&csiphy_mxc_opp_table>;
+
+				interrupts = <GIC_SPI 479 IRQ_TYPE_EDGE_RISING>;
+
+				power-domains = <&camcc CAM_CC_TITAN_TOP_GDSC>,
+						<&rpmhpd RPMHPD_MXC>,
+						<&rpmhpd RPMHPD_MMCX>;
+				power-domain-names = "top",
+						     "mx",
+						     "mmcx";
+
+				#phy-cells = <1>;
+
+				status = "disabled";
+			};
+
+			csiphy4: phy@acec000 {
+				compatible = "qcom,x1e80100-csi2-phy";
+				reg = <0 0x0acec000 0 0x2000>;
+
+				clocks = <&camcc CAM_CC_CSIPHY4_CLK>,
+					 <&camcc CAM_CC_CSI4PHYTIMER_CLK>,
+					 <&camcc CAM_CC_CAMNOC_AXI_RT_CLK>,
+					 <&camcc CAM_CC_CPAS_AHB_CLK>;
+				clock-names = "csiphy",
+					      "csiphy_timer",
+					      "camnoc_axi",
+					      "cpas_ahb";
+
+				operating-points-v2 = <&csiphy_mxa_opp_table>;
+
+				interrupts = <GIC_SPI 122 IRQ_TYPE_EDGE_RISING>;
+
+				power-domains = <&camcc CAM_CC_TITAN_TOP_GDSC>,
+						<&rpmhpd RPMHPD_MX>,
+						<&rpmhpd RPMHPD_MMCX>;
+				power-domain-names = "top",
+						     "mx",
+						     "mmcx";
+
+				#phy-cells = <1>;
+
+				status = "disabled";
+			};
+
+			csiphy_mxc_opp_table: opp-table-mxc {
+				compatible = "operating-points-v2";
+
+				opp-300000000 {
+					opp-hz = /bits/ 64 <300000000>;
+					required-opps = <&rpmhpd_opp_low_svs_d1>,
+							<&rpmhpd_opp_low_svs_d1>;
+				};
+
+				opp-400000000 {
+					opp-hz = /bits/ 64 <400000000>;
+					required-opps = <&rpmhpd_opp_low_svs>,
+							<&rpmhpd_opp_low_svs>;
+				};
+
+				opp-480000000 {
+					opp-hz = /bits/ 64 <480000000>;
+					required-opps = <&rpmhpd_opp_low_svs>,
+							<&rpmhpd_opp_low_svs>;
+				};
+			};
+
+			csiphy_mxa_opp_table: opp-table-mxa {
+				compatible = "operating-points-v2";
+
+				opp-300000000 {
+					opp-hz = /bits/ 64 <300000000>;
+					required-opps = <&rpmhpd_opp_low_svs_d1>,
+							<&rpmhpd_opp_low_svs_d1>;
+				};
+
+				opp-400000000 {
+					opp-hz = /bits/ 64 <400000000>;
+					required-opps = <&rpmhpd_opp_low_svs>,
+							<&rpmhpd_opp_low_svs>;
+				};
+
+				opp-480000000 {
+					opp-hz = /bits/ 64 <480000000>;
+					required-opps = <&rpmhpd_opp_low_svs>,
+							<&rpmhpd_opp_low_svs>;
+				};
+			};
+		};
+
 		camcc: clock-controller@ade0000 {
 			compatible = "qcom,x1e80100-camcc";
 			reg = <0 0x0ade0000 0 0x20000>;
